Summary:The focus of this text is an area known as "Est de Montréal". This area had been associated with the petrochemical industry and other manufacturing sectors for much of the twentieth century. However, due to the crisis of Fordism and the development of the technology-based economy, this area progressively lost its productive assets, which provoked important impacts on jobs, services, and the quality of life for its residents. Such a decline has motivated an important mobilization for an economic reconversion oriented towards the socio-ecological transition. The text discusses the situation of the area, the issues at stake in the process of reconversion, the launching and orientations of a group of socioeconomic actors called “Alliance pour l’Est de Montréal”, the sources of inspiration for this group, as well as the elements of a strategy for ecological and societal transition in this important area of the city.
